2011-04-04 23 views
6

Son birkaç haftadır Web Kullanıcı Arabirimi Testi otomatikleştirmek için Windows Powershell komut dosyaları oluşturuyorum. Bugüne kadar iyi çalıştılar, onları koştum ve milyonlarca istisna var. Ben el ile InternetExplorer nesnesi oluşturmak için çalıştık:Açık Tarayıcı sadece Powershell çalışmayı durdurdu

$ie = new-object -com "InternetExplorer.Application" 

Ve bu hatayı alıyorum:

New-Object : Creating an instance of the COM component with CLSID {0002DF01-0000-0000-C000-000000000046} from the IClassFactory failed due to the following error: 800704a6. 
At line:1 char:17 + $ie = new-object <<<< -com "InternetExplorer.Application" 

Bu benim InternetExplorer çalıştırmak için tekrar tekrar kullanmakta ve aynı kodudur. Neden aniden çalışmayı bıraktı ve nasıl düzeltebilirim?

+2

Pencereleri yeniden başlatmayı denediniz mi? Bazı yayınlara göre sorun, bekleyen kapatma olduğunu gösteriyor. – stej

cevap

7

Garip, o hata iletisi bu karşılık gelir:

A system shutdown has already been scheduled. (Exception from HRESULT: 0x800704A6)

IE güncellemek veya başka bir makine yeniden gerektiren bir şey yüklediniz mi?

+0

Bildiğim kadarıyla değil. Ama sanırım bir yeniden başlatma zarar görmeyebilir. Çalıştığım bir saniye içinde tekrar – Loogawa

+0

Yea olacağım. Aptalca hissediyorum ki yeniden başlatmayı düşünmedim. Ama bilgisayarım neredeyse hiç çalışmıyor ve IE kullanmadım. Teşekkürler! – Loogawa

İlgili konular